Hello there,
Was just curious if it was possible to use Dark GDK.Net with Microsofts Gamestdio? And if so would it be possible to make small games for the Xbox 360?

Dark GDK.Net just wraps regular DarkGDK, meaning it doesn't use the managed DirectX or whatever XBox 360 would use. So NO I don't think it would be possible.

You can reference the Game Studio dll's and use the input features for the Xbox controller on PC, but not the other way around. To do this with XNA installed, just add a reference to Microsoft.Xna.Input and use the pre-made Xbox360 controller wrappers.
